Change Stereo for Bluetooth and USB functions

I currently have the BMW professional stereo and am looking to change it so i have bluetooth and a USB port. I have a sony mex-3600(i think) from an old car which I was hoping to put in.

After reading some threads and contacting BMW (who said it couldn't be done), it seams I can't just replace the head unit ith a facia and a wiring adapter.

I found a company called Dynamic Sounds and they said I need the following:
AutoLeads PCF-100 (Ariel adapter) - £7.99
Autoleads FP-06-06 (Facia) - £9.99
Connects2 CTSBM005 (to keep Steering controls) £33.95 + £5 for cable
Connects2 CTRBM001 (to keep PDC) £39.95

Is this the best/cheapest option?

It's almost certainly the cheapest but not one that I would go for myself.

Probably just me being middle-aged but I don't like to have anything non-oem in my car. The solution I would go for is either the Dension Gateway 500 or mObridge interface. However you will be talking many hundreds of pounds rather than tens!
